Division of the Synod of Philadelphia. The Committee of Bills and Overtures reported, without any expression of opinion, the requests of certain Presbyteries belonging to the Synods of Philadelphia and Virginia, to be constituted into a new Synod. Whereupon, the following resolution was presented by the Rev. Stuart Robinson: Resolved, That the requests of these four Presbyteries be granted, and that the Presbyteries of Carlisle, Baltimore, and Eastern Shore, from the Synod of Philadelphia, and the Presbytery of Winchester, from the Synod of Virginia, be hereby set off and constituted a new Synod, to be called the Synod of , which body shall meet in the F Street Church in the city of Washington, on the last Tuesday, (31st) of October next at 7~ P. M., and be opened with a sermon by the Rev. Win. S. Plumer, D. D., or in his absence by the oldest minister present, who shall preside till another Moderator be chosen; and that thereafter the Synod convene on their own adjournment." After an extended discussion, the resolution was adopted, and the blank was filled with "Baltimore," as the name of the new Synod. -Division of the Synod of Pittsburgh.
